Output 0585559cd76d5742489330e426db23ad8a967ac6368df7771dd5d55f185de4bd:109

value
11928
script pubkey
OP_0 OP_PUSHBYTES_20 2529b14f5d11924a743eabdbf8678262d81a85e1
address
bc1qy55mzn6azxfy5ap740dlseuzvtvp4p0pxgw5p0
transaction
0585559cd76d5742489330e426db23ad8a967ac6368df7771dd5d55f185de4bd
spent
true